Implements ascii_fx_zone effect that allows applying arbitrary sexp effects to each character cell via cell_effect lambdas. Each cell is rendered as a small image that effects can operate on. Key changes: - New ascii_fx_zone effect with cell_effect parameter for per-cell transforms - Zone context (row, col, lum, sat, hue, etc.) available in cell_effect lambdas - Effects are now loaded explicitly from recipe declarations, not auto-loaded - Added effects_registry to plan for explicit effect dependency tracking - Updated effect definition syntax across all sexp effects - New run_staged.py for executing staged recipes - Example recipes demonstrating alternating rotation and blur/rgb_split patterns Co-Authored-By: Claude Opus 4.5 <noreply@anthropic.com>
